Here is the northern turning point of the so-called Kanonenbahn cycle path. The cycle path between Frieda (Meinhard) and Dingelstädt, set up in the former second track bed, was only completed in October 2019.

Today I went on a bike ride from Frida in Hesse to Dingelstädt in Thuringia. It's a nice, easy-to-ride path, but from Frieda onward it's always uphill, but manageable except for a few short stretches. The tunnels are a great way to cool off on warm days. The longest tunnel on this route is 1,530 meters. Check it out.
